The Commissary is the place for surprises. I say this because they do not advertise their sales. You have to go to the store to find the surprise deals. Overall the prices in the commissary are hard to beat their prices. Some of their items may be found for cheaper prices at other grocery stores. The difference in my opinion are the low meat prices and the wide selection of international foods. They also have a sushi bar and the deli prepares hot and cold sandwiches. The long lines at the commissary are deceiving. The lines always move quickly and the baggers will take your groceries to your car. The baggers do not work the commissary, they are paid through tips only, so this keeps the cost a little lower.
